HotPixels removes hot pixel noise from long exposure images using dark frame profiles and machine learning. It Works on RAW DNG files to minimize correction artifacts. It integrates with Lightroom as a plugin.
Hot pixels are erroneously high pixel values that appear as bright red, green, or blue spots. They're consistent across frames from the same sensor.

Hot pixels in RAW data appear as single bright pixels. When RAW images are processed, during demosaicing, these bloom into colored blobs affecting surrounding pixels. If we fix them in the raw image, the overall impact is minimized.

Shoot dark frames (lens cap on) and analyze to identify persistent hot pixels. Profiles include sensor metadata (ISO, shutter speed, temperature) for matching to target images.
Three correction stages:
- Subtract Dark Frame: Remove noise floor using mean dark frame
- Remove Hot Pixels: Replace hot pixels with interpolated values
- Residual Hot Pixel Detection: Neural network detects remaining random hot pixels
Manage profiles for different cameras, settings, and temperatures. Auto-matches profiles to target images.

This project relies on a couple of complex dependencies:
- dngio: A library for reading / writing DNG files. Currently supports Windows and Mac.
- exiftool: An excellent tool for extracting EXIF data from images. It is uniquely capable of extracting vendor-specific tags from DNG files. This is a Perl application that is automatically fetched and installed, if not already present on system.
